使用SVN管理SVN挂钩?

时间:2009-08-31 11:48:12

标签: svn hook svn-hooks

据我所知,SVN本身没有内置的功能来管理SVN挂钩。当然有一些想法,例如另一个带有钩子脚本的存储库,在提交时向svn export目录运行hooks,但是你会怎么做?

2 个答案:

答案 0 :(得分:2)

我认为将hooks目录设置为subversion checkout没有任何问题。因此,在提交钩子之后,您只需要在钩子目录中svn up作为提交后操作。

我认为它也可以使hooks目录检查它正在管理的存储库。

答案 1 :(得分:2)

我在我的一个存储库中有SVN管理的钩子。但这不是同一个存储库;我创建了第二个SVN存储库来保存第一个存储库的挂钩。我担心通过错误的提交来破坏对主要仓库的访问。